Dead Man's Switch is a Unique Perk belonging to The Deathslinger.
Prestige The Deathslinger to Prestige 1, 2, 3 respectively to unlock Tier I, Tier II, Tier III of Dead Man's Switch for all other Characters.
Description
After hooking a Survivor, Dead Man's Switch activates for the next 20/25/30 seconds:
- While activated, any Survivor that stops repairing a Generator before it is fully repaired causes The Entity to block the Generator until Dead Man's Switch's effect ends.
- Affected Generators are highlighted by a white Aura.

Change Log
Patch 5.5.0
- Buff: removed the Obsession mechanic, now activates on hooking any Survivor.
Patch 6.1.2
- Nerf: reduced the duration to 20/25/30 seconds.
- This change was due to the former synergy with Scourge Hook: Pain Resonance having been restored in the same patch.
Trivia
- Dead Man's Switch will also block Generators being repaired by multiple Survivors as long as any one of them decides to stop repairing during the activation window.
- A "Dead Man's Switch" is a common safety feature found on heavy machinery, where a switch must be held continuously in order for a machine to keep operating.
